The History of Earth Day

Rose Hirsch, Emmet, Marvin & Martin, LLP

 

We celebrate Earth Day each year on April 22nd to demonstrate support for environmental protection. The first Earth Day was celebrated on April 22, 1970, and was organized by Senator Gaylord Nelson. He started spreading his teachings on college campuses and chose this day to maximize the greatest student participation. It is a weekday between Spring break and final exams. It now includes a wide range of events celebrated globally, which includes one billion...

Plastics vs. Planet

Elba Cortes, Fox Rothschild, LLP

 

Founded more than 50 years ago, EarthDay.org has mobilized billions of people across the globe in an effort to protect our planet. This year’s theme is “Planet v. Plastics.”

 

Plastics are everywhere, they clog land, air and water. A major concern with plastics is the chemical additives they contain, which pose adverse effects on both human and...
